Skip to content

Superseded pr17: drag-drop new structure#28

Merged
unkcpz merged 10 commits intomainfrom
pr-17
Dec 13, 2025
Merged

Superseded pr17: drag-drop new structure#28
unkcpz merged 10 commits intomainfrom
pr-17

Conversation

@unkcpz
Copy link
Copy Markdown
Member

@unkcpz unkcpz commented Nov 26, 2025

see #17, I did wrong push and close that PR. Reopen it here with commits form @GeigerJ2

xyz file for test

12
Benzene C6H6
C      0.000000     1.396792     0.000000
C      1.209657     0.698396     0.000000
C      1.209657    -0.698396     0.000000
C      0.000000    -1.396792     0.000000
C     -1.209657    -0.698396     0.000000
C     -1.209657     0.698396     0.000000
H      0.000000     2.490291     0.000000
H      2.156659     1.245145     0.000000
H      2.156659    -1.245145     0.000000
H      0.000000    -2.490291     0.000000
H     -2.156659    -1.245145     0.000000
H     -2.156659     1.245145     0.000000

@unkcpz
Copy link
Copy Markdown
Member Author

unkcpz commented Nov 26, 2025

rebase and almost works.

  • bug0: default structure is there before the default structure button is clicked.
  • bug1: after load the new structure from xyz, the load default only flash to the default structure but flash back to the newly loaded one.
  • bug2: seems there are now two light entities.
  • bug3: a hidden error in the log when click default structure load button when structure is loaded.
  • bug4: when attach light, the angle of light is not kept but from initial value.
  • bug5: the first click on the attach didn't switch the button text.
  • to improve: after feat: light on/off #10 there are buttons on the left up corners, overlap with button and text added is this PR.

I'll fix them in this PR.

@unkcpz unkcpz merged commit 7f8929a into main Dec 13, 2025
3 checks passed
@unkcpz unkcpz deleted the pr-17 branch December 13, 2025 00:19
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ants